    1984 force 125 low compression question?

    Don't tear the motor down, replace the fuel pump!!!! The fuel pump is more than just the diaphram, it's got check valves too. The check valves prevent fuel from going into the cylinder and compressed air going into the fuel line. Fuel pump is probably less expensive that buying head gaskets.

    1987 15hp Evinrude starts but quits every time.

    Lots of folks here tell us that they cleaned the carb really good. To one guy that meant draining the gas out of the bowls and spraying a can of "gumout" into the drain holes of the carburetors. In order to fully clean that carb, you'll need to get a carb kit and you need to remove some plugs...
